Simple Suppressors introduces practical firearm suppressors to Project Zomboid Build 42 without adding new firearms or external dependencies. Suppressors utilize a dedicated muzzle slot that coexists with weapon lights and match ammunition calibers at runtime, supporting both vanilla and modded firearms. Shot range and volume are reduced through configurable sandbox settings.

Features:

  • 14 suppressors across seven calibers in two tiers: Machined (quieter) and Oil-filter (cheaper, heavier, louder)
  • Runtime caliber matching for automatic compatibility with modded firearms
  • Dedicated muzzle attachment point allowing simultaneous use of weapon lights
  • Craftable components and finished suppressors with configurable loot spawn rates
  • Server-safe implementation for solo and multiplayer modes

Suppressor Tiers:

  • Machined: Built from welded baffle stacks; offers the quietest performance
  • Oil-filter: Crafted from scavenged vehicle oil filters; cheaper and faster to make but less effective

Supported Calibers:

  • 12 Gauge: Pump and sawn-off shotguns (excluding double-barrel)
  • 5.56: Assault rifle, varmint rifle
  • 9mm: Pistols
  • .45: .45 pistol, trapper carbine
  • .308: Hunting rifle, battle rifle
  • .357: Lever-action carbine
  • .44: Desert Eagle and .44 Magnum revolver

Crafting:

All items are crafted at a welding setup using a blowtorch and welding mask. Recipes are learned from the Improvised Suppressors Manual , found in libraries, garages, gun stores, and mechanic workshops. Baffle cutting is known by default.

  • Baffles: Cut from small sheet metal (Hacksaw or Blowtorch)
  • Baffle Stack: Weld six baffles around an iron pipe (Metalworking 3)
  • Caliber Adapter: Thread a caliber mount from an iron pipe (Metalworking 1)
  • Machined Suppressor: Combine baffle stack, iron pipe, and caliber adapter (Metalworking 2)
  • Oil-filter Suppressor: Combine scavenged oil filter, hand drill, and caliber adapter (Metalworking 1)

Vehicle Mechanics:

Players can remove oil filters from vehicles to salvage them for crafting. Driving without an oil filter causes gradual engine damage. Removal time and wear rates are configurable via sandbox options.

Sound Configuration:

  • Hearing Radius: Default 20% (controls zombie detection range)
  • Volume: Default 55% (controls auditory loudness)
